Most people assume that “i” in iPhone stands for Internet. That’s true. But there’s more to it.

The first Apple product with an “i” prefix was Apple’s iMac which was released back in 1998. This product was revolutionary because it brought access to the Internet to common people. While launching the iMac, Steve Jobs confirmed that “I” in iMac stands for Internet as the Mac computer brings internet connectivity. But Steve Jobs further clarified that “I” also has some other meanings: Internet, individual, instruct, inform, and inspire. Let me explain a bit.

Decoding the "i" in iPhone
  • Internet: The “i” emphasizes Apple’s commitment to the internet and the seamless integration of online capabilities into their devices.
  • Individual: Reflecting a focus on the individual user, Apple products were designed to be user-friendly and tailored to meet personal needs.
  • Instruct: The “i” also signifies Apple’s dedication to providing intuitive and easy-to-understand products that guide users effortlessly.
  • Inform: Apple products aim to inform users, whether through access to information on the internet or by offering tools for personal expression and creativity.
  • Inspire: Lastly, the “i” represents the aspiration to inspire users to unleash their creativity and potential through technology.

Over the years, the “i” has continued to be a key element in Apple’s product lineup. Apple went ahead to launch iPod, iPhone, and iMac. Each product under the “i” umbrella embodies the principles of innovation, connectivity, and individual empowerment. With time, “i” became a symbol of Apple’s broader ecosystem with services like iCloud, iTunes, and iOS.

In recent years, Apple has dropped “i” from new products such as the Apple Watch, Apple Vision Pro, Apple Music, HomePod, Apple Pencil, and more. This decision could be Apple’s desire to create distinct brand identities for certain product categories. The choice of naming convention is also a part of Apple’s marketing strategy.
